About the role

As the QLD Technical Manager reporting to the National Customer Experience Manager, you'll lead our technical operations across the state, bringing together a high-performing team of espresso machine specialists to deliver best-in-class service to our customers.

You will:

  • Lead, coach and support the QLD Technical Team to ensure exceptional technical support and service delivery.
  • Drive continuous improvement in technical operations, focusing on speed, quality, and customer experience.
  • Oversee scheduling, callouts, installs, inventory and parts management across the region.
  • Foster a culture of accountability, collaboration, and knowledge-sharing within the team and across Allpress.
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with key suppliers (e.g. La Marzocco), customers, and internal teams.
  • Coordinate team resourcing, performance reviews, and ongoing technical training.
  • Work closely with Sales, Training, and Customer Service to ensure seamless support and proactive problem-solving.
  • Represent the Allpress brand as an approachable expert in every customer interaction and leadership moment.

This is a full-time role based in Brisbane. You'll be part of a national technical leadership group and play a key role in shaping how we support coffee excellence across the country.

About you

  • You're a strong people leader — organised, approachable, and experienced in motivating skilled technicians.
  • You know your way around commercial espresso equipment and have the confidence to support a team across technical callouts, installs, and service workflows.
  • You're systems-savvy and able to manage inventory, scheduling and reporting processes with accuracy and efficiency.
  • You take pride in delivering responsive, high-quality service to customers.
  • You're proactive, solutions-focused, and committed to continuous improvement — both in your own work and your team's.
